How traditional Decred mining works

Decred combines proof-of-work miners with proof-of-stake ticket voters. Miners assemble blocks; stakeholders vote on those blocks and on consensus changes. That hybrid design is the main operational difference versus Bitcoin-style PoW-only coins.

Historically, Decred PoW used BLAKE-256 with 14 rounds (Blake256R14-dcr). DCP-0011 changed the PoW hash to BLAKE3 while the block hash remains BLAKE-256 14-round. The Blake256R14-dcr machines on this site (DR5, Whatsminer D1, StrongU) are that older generation. Verify current pool and firmware support before you treat those units as live Decred hardware.

Decred mining pools

Use a pool that states which PoW hash it expects (BLAKE3 vs legacy Blake256R14-dcr):

  • Decred-aware pools: Check MiningPoolStats for currently advertised DCR stratum.
  • dcrpool: Official stratum implementation; operators run PPS or PPLNS. Default miner port :5550.
  • 2Miners: Multi-coin operator; confirm the DCR algorithm listed on their coin page before pointing ASICs.

Decred mining algorithm

Do not assume “Decred ASIC” means current consensus. Pre-DCP-0011 ASICs hash Blake256R14-dcr. After DCP-0011, the PoW hash is BLAKE3. A machine that only speaks the old hash will not earn on a BLAKE3 pool.

Ticket voting is separate: you lock DCR for a ticket, then vote. Mining and staking can be done by different people. Miners still need a DCR address for coinbase.

How to set up a Decred mining rig

  • 1. Confirm the live PoW hash

    Read Decred mining docs and your pool’s algorithm line. If the pool wants BLAKE3, a Blake256R14-dcr-only ASIC will not work.

  • 2. Set up a Decred wallet

    Use Decrediton or another listed wallet. Save a mainnet address for pool payouts.

  • 3. Configure the miner

    Point stratum at a pool that matches your firmware. dcrpool’s default listen port is 5550 when you run your own pool.

  • 4. Be cautious with firmware

    Only vendor or Decred-documented firmware. Random “DCR BLAKE3” images are a high-risk category.

  • 5. Start mining

    Watch both miner hashrate and whether the pool is actually finding DCR blocks. Coinbase maturity is 256 blocks.
